Output 66ef833d7d531b787adc9d10d3d94fed8695c5ff59e14dfab6f5b4391b572702:1

value
3025024
script pubkey
OP_0 OP_PUSHBYTES_20 daf11d617f19a3e542f607de656832593496b09a
address
bc1qmtc36ctlrx372shkql0x26pjty6fdvy6duxqvp
transaction
66ef833d7d531b787adc9d10d3d94fed8695c5ff59e14dfab6f5b4391b572702
spent
true